Como devs, a gente nunca pode se acomodar e o entendimento de frameworks é sempre um diferencial. Todo dia o salto tecnológico apenas avança e as inovações deste universo de desenvolvimento não param. O crescimento exponencial das Inteligências Artificias serve para nos lembrar disso e da necessidade de seguirmos nos profissionalizando. Por isso, criei uma lista de 8 frameworks que vão impulsionar sua carreira como dev. É claro que, se você trabalha com programação, já conhece alguns deles ou talvez até todos. Mas o importante mesmo é que você consiga enxergar aquilo que pode ser seu foco para os próximos meses, a fim de se diferenciar no mercado de trabalho. Confira!
ASP.NET
Lançado pela primeira vez há mais de duas décadas, este framework foi desenvolvido pela gigante de tecnologia Microsoft. Ele usa a linguagem C#, é de código aberto e serve muito bem para devs de back-end. O conceito é simples: utilizar o .NET para desenvolver aplicativos da Web, sendo sempre bem rápido e poderoso, apesar de estar em cena há muito tempo.
React
A Meta criou e agora mantém esta biblioteca JavaScript de front-end. Na verdade, o React não é bem um framework, mas o funcionamento é bastante parecido, sendo muito útil para desenvolver interfaces de usuário para aplicativos da Web de página única. Além disso, é mais uma opção de código aberto. Inclusive, estamos com uma oportunidade de trabalho aberta nesta área, com foco em React Native.
Django
Outra opção para devs de back-end, o Django é baseado na linguagem Python e também é de código aberto. Ele é muito poderoso e possui um alto desempenho, o que o torna uma opção perfeita para projetos de maior complexidade. Além disso, é um dos frameworks mais seguros que você vai encontrar. Inclusive, alguns dos sites mais famosos do mundo, como o Instagram e o Spotify, foram criados usando o Django.
Ruby on Rails
Pouco tempo atrás, tivemos um artigo escrito por um Impulser PRO sobre a linguagem de programação Ruby. Pois bem, o Ruby on Rails é um framework baseado nesta linguagem e oferece vários benefícios: é rápido, confiável e escalável. Além disso, é mais uma opção para devs de back-end. E dentro desta estrutura, nós também temos uma oportunidade, hein?
Angular
O Angular é uma estrutura de front-end de código aberto baseada em JavaScript. PayPal, Netflix e Upwork são alguns dos exemplos de aplicativos construídos com este framework. Criada pelo Google, é uma das preferidas de empresas porque pode lidar com projetos de grande escala. Além disso, também temos uma oportunidade de trabalho aqui.
Express
Este é um framework baseado em JavaScript e o foco é para devs de back-end. E, mais uma vez, temos empresas de grande porte utilizando-o: Accenture, IBM e Uber. Apesar de não possuir muitos recursos, é uma opção bem rápida.
Laravel
Esta é uma opção incrível para criar aplicativos Web de pequena e média escala, além de ser baseada em PHP e ser mais um framework de código aberto. Por fim, possui suporte à API e, vez ou outra, a Impulso tem alguma oportunidade aberta nesta área.
Vue
Por último, mas não menos importante, o Vue é um framework de código aberto para desenvolvimento front-end baseado em JavaScript, sendo particularmente uma ótima opção para criar aplicativos de página única rapidamente. Inclusive, é também uma opção para quem trabalha com UI (User Interface), já que nele é fácil de criar aplicativos de boa aparência.
Outras dicas
Agora que já sabe em quais frameworks focar, vale tirar um tempo e conversar com outros e outras devs. Para isso, minha recomendação é participar da nossa Comunidade no Discord, onde temos eventos de desenvolvimento e carreira, coworking, challenges e até mesmo cupons de desconto. Te vejo lá!